A Feather on the Breath of God was the first release by the early music ensemble Gothic Voices, founded in 1980 by Christopher Page. Anthony Rooley's 1982 album of Monteverdi madrigals sung and played by the Consort of Musicke is both an appealing set of performances of some of the composer's most beguiling works and a handy snapshot of early Baroque performance practice as it was understood at the time.
